Compare all specifications:
1978 Fiat 128 | 2011 Volkswagen GTI | |
Make | Fiat | Volkswagen |
Model | 128 | GTI |
Year Released | 1978 | 2011 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1116 cc | 2000 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 53 HP | 200 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 5100 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Vehicle Length | 3880 mm | 4211 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1600 mm | 1778 mm |
